What if Naruto didn't grow up in Konoha? What if, instead of living in a village that hated him... he was raised above the world - by the Sage of Six Paths himself? In this story, Naruto is taken right after birth and raised in a hidden sky-realm by Hagoromo Ōtsutsuki. He grows up learning peace, power, and everything about the world... except how to live in it. He's curious. He watches people from above. And one day, he sees a boy with cold eyes - someone who feels way too familiar. That moment changes everything. Because even if Naruto was meant to stay away... his heart says otherwise. --- This is a Naruto AU where he grows up far from the world, but finds his way back - not for revenge, but for connection.
